A tool designed to estimate the cost of welding projects typically considers factors such as material costs, labor rates, equipment expenses, and overhead. For instance, such a tool might allow users to input the type and length of weld, material grade, and labor costs to generate an estimated total project cost.
Accurate cost estimation is crucial for successful project management in the welding industry. This type of tool provides valuable support for budgeting, bidding, and overall project planning. Historically, cost estimation relied on manual calculations and experience-based estimations, often leading to inaccuracies and potential project overruns. The advent of digital tools allows for greater precision and efficiency in this process, benefiting both welders and their clients.
